Rugged and wild adventure describe Komodo best. Home to the infamous Komodo Dragons, Komodo is one of the most species-diverse locations in Indonesia. Cruise along the crystal-clear waters of the Indonesian archipelago and take in the breathtaking pink sand beaches. Diving in Komodo isn’t for the faint-hearted. Due to strong currents, you can expect to be taken for a ride as you float through The Cauldron, also known as Shotgun. You’ll also experience Komodo’s world-famous dive site, Manta Alley. There you can spot dozens of manta rays swirling through a feeding station. Night dives are also an adventure. There you can see colorful nudibranchs, crustaceans, eels, frogfish, and octopus.
If you are interested in marine life, Komodo is the place for you. They have 260 species of reef-building coral, 70 sponge species, and 1,000 fish species. Komodo National Park is popular for its macro-lovers, and its slopes and walls of coral house a myriad of critters.

The Aurora Liveaboard is a beautiful Pinisi-styled teak motor-sail dive liveaboard that combines tradition with comfort and modern conveniences. It can host up to 18 divers and each cabin has air conditioning and private bathrooms. The upper deck is where you prepare for each dive and offers diving equipment and a photo/video room.
Guests’ quarters are located on the main deck. The liveaboard can house up to 18 people, with each cabin having either one king bed, two single beds, or a combination of both. Each cabin also has its own private bathroom and air conditioning. Sit back, relax, and get ready to dive!
